On 4th June 1489 Antoine Lorraine II Duke Lorraine was born to René Lorraine II Duke Lorraine Duke of Bar [aged 38] and Philippa Egmont Duchess of Bar Duchess Lorraine [aged 22] at Bar le Duc. He married 26th June 1515 his second cousin once removed Renée Bourbon Duchess Lorraine and had issue.
In 1491 Anne Lorraine died at Bar le Duc.
On 24th November 1502 Catherine Lorraine was born to René Lorraine II Duke Lorraine Duke of Bar [aged 51] and Philippa Egmont Duchess of Bar Duchess Lorraine [aged 35] at Bar le Duc.
On 24th November 1502 Claude Lorraine was born to René Lorraine II Duke Lorraine Duke of Bar [aged 51] and Philippa Egmont Duchess of Bar Duchess Lorraine [aged 35] at Bar le Duc.
On 22nd November 1515 Mary of Guise Queen Consort Scotland was born to Claude Lorraine 1st Duke Guise [aged 19] and Antoinette Bourbon Duchess of Guise [aged 22] at Bar le Duc. She married (1) 4th August 1534 her fifth cousin once removed Louis Valois II Duke Longueville, son of Louis Valois I Duke Longueville and Johanna Hochberg Duchess Longueville, and had issue (2) 18th June 1538 her third cousin King James V of Scotland, son of King James IV of Scotland and Margaret Tudor Queen Scotland, and had issue.
On 17th February 1519 Francis II Duke Guise was born to Claude Lorraine 1st Duke Guise [aged 22] and Antoinette Bourbon Duchess of Guise [aged 26] at Bar le Duc. He married 29th April 1548 his third cousin once removed Anna d'Este, daughter of Ercole Este II Duke Ferrara and Renée of France Duchess of Ferrara, and had issue.
In 1554 Marguerite Egmont [aged 37] died in Bar le Duc.

The Gesta Normannorum Ducum [The Deeds of the Dukes of Normandy] is a landmark medieval chronicle tracing the rise and fall of the Norman dynasty from its early roots through the pivotal events surrounding the Norman Conquest of England. Originally penned in Latin by the monk William of Jumièges shortly before 1060 and later expanded at the behest of William the Conqueror, the work chronicles the deeds, politics, battles, and leadership of the Norman dukes, especially William’s own claim to the English throne. The narrative combines earlier historical sources with firsthand information and oral testimony to present an authoritative account of Normandy’s transformation from a Viking settlement into one of medieval Europe’s most powerful realms. William’s history emphasizes the legitimacy, military prowess, and governance of the Norman line, framing their expansion, including the conquest of England, as both divinely sanctioned and noble in purpose. Later chroniclers such as Orderic Vitalis and Robert of Torigni continued the history, extending the coverage into the 12th century, providing broader context on ducal rule and its impact. Today this classic work remains a foundational source for understanding Norman identity, medieval statesmanship, and the historical forces that reshaped England and Western Europe between 800AD and 1100AD.

On 26th February 1551 Catherine of Lorraine was born to Nicholas of Lorraine Duke of Mercœur [aged 26] and Marguerite Egmont [aged 34] in Nomeny. She died young.
On 9th April 1552 Henri of Lorraine Count of Chaligny was born to Nicholas of Lorraine Duke of Mercœur [aged 27] and Marguerite Egmont [aged 35] in Nomeny.
On 30th April 1553 Louise Lorraine Queen Consort France was born to Nicholas of Lorraine Duke of Mercœur [aged 28] and Marguerite Egmont [aged 36] in Nomeny. She married 14th February 1575 her fourth cousin Henry III King France.
In 1561 Cardinal Charles de Lorraine was born to Nicholas of Lorraine Duke of Mercœur [aged 36] and Princess Joanna of Savoy Nemours [aged 29] in Nomeny.
On 14th May 1564 Marguerite of Lorraine was born to Nicholas of Lorraine Duke of Mercœur [aged 39] and Princess Joanna of Savoy Nemours [aged 32] in Nomeny. She married 18th September 1581 Anne de Batarnay Duke of Joyeus.
On 12th April 1566 Claude of Lorraine was born to Nicholas of Lorraine Duke of Mercœur [aged 41] and Princess Joanna of Savoy Nemours [aged 34] in Nomeny. He died young.
